I have no experience with containers so forgive me if I'm missing
something. Why couldn't you just have a 'microinit.rpm' in a separate dnf
repo, put 'Obsoletes: systemd' into that package? This way people who are
building hundreds of containers that do not require systemd can use the repo containing
microinit and it will take the place of systemd. RPM macro's could be provided by the
microinit rpm, so it would provide reasonable replacements for %systemd_requires,
%systemd_post, etc. I think this could solve your concern with minimum (no) impact to
bare metal installs.
because in that case a dependency of a package which really requires
systemd would no longer work and it's only a dirty hack
